Medical Laboratory Scientist Group Lead

4 months ago


Neptune City, United States Quest Diagnostics Full time

Overview:
**Medical Laboratory Scientist Group Lead - Neptune, NJ - Monday - Friday (Rotational Weekends) - 7:00AM-3:30PM**

**Quest Diagnostics is hiring a Medical Laboratory Scientist Group Lead in Neptune, NJ. This role is a hospital-based position at Jersey Shore.**

Perform test procedures of moderate/high complexity requiring the exercise of independent judgement and responsibility in those specialties in which they are qualified by education, training and experience. Assist Lab Supervisor and serve as a technical resource for the department.

**Responsibilities**:

- Demonstrate proficiency in all duties of a Medical Technologist I and II.
- Perform and report on assigned analytical tests in accordance with applicable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) ensuring that applicable quality control requirements are met.
- Actively support and comply with laboratory policies and procedures for specimen handling and processing, test analysis, reporting and maintaining records of patient test results.
- Adhere to analytical schedules to maintain turnaround time of results including STATS or critical results to clients.
- Perform, review and document QC analysis to ensure accuracy of clinical data and proper instrument function. Make quality control decisions regarding the disposition of an assay or test.
- Review requests for validity checks and recommend an appropriate course of action taking into account the limitations of specimen requirements and the effects of time and the quality of additional and/or repeat testing.
- Serve as a technical resource for the department by investigating and resolving analytical testing problems, recommending a course of action in instances identified as beyond acceptable limits, and responding to non-routine/complex inquiries and/or requests from clients and sales representatives.
- Assist Lab Supervisor by monitoring workflow to meet testing schedules; distributing and reviewing work assignments; training employees in laboratory techniques; resolving work-related problems of staff; and providing input for performance appraisals and disciplinary actions.
- Expedite the flow of work to maximize productive capacity by evaluating production systems and recommending enhancements and coordinating the resolution of production problems/issues involving other laboratory departments.
- Maintain laboratory areas and equipment in a safe, functional and sanitary condition.
- Complete training and competency checklists as appropriate and assist with the department’s annual competency testing process and documentation.
- Adheres to all established CLIA, HIPAA, OSHA, and laboratory safety requirements and reviews department activities to ensure compliance.
- Required to use (a) personal protective equipment, (b) engineering controls and/or (c) work practice controls as directed by management.
- Participate in government or regulatory agency inspections, if needed.
- Perform necessary supervisor functions in the absence of a Supervisor, if qualified and delegated.
- Other duties as assigned. This is not an exhaustive list of all duties and responsibilities, but rather a general description of work performed by the position.

Qualifications:
QUALIFICATIONS

**Required Work Experience**:
Three (3) to five (5) years of clinical experience as a Medical Technologist within the designated discipline.

**Preferred Work Experience**:
Experience as a Medical Technologist at Quest is highly desired.

**Physical and Mental Requirements**:

- The normal performance of duties may require lifting and carrying objects: Objects 1 to 10 pounds are lifted and carried frequently; objects 11 to 25 pounds are lifted and carried occasionally; objects 36 to 50 pounds are seldom lifted or carried and objects over 50 pounds are not to be lifted or carried without assistance.
- Ability to stand and work at the bench for long periods of time.
- Frequent walking and/or standing.
- May be required to use a wide variety of manual and automated pipettes and laboratory instruments and apparatuses all of which demand significant manual dexterity.

**Knowledge**:

- Comprehensive theoretical and operational job knowledge in designated specialty required.
- Knowledge of organizational/departmental policies and procedures.

**Skills**:

- Proven leadership and problem-solving skills.
- Must be detail-oriented, have the ability to work independently, establish work priorities for self and others and to handle several tasks simultaneously for maximum department efficiency.
- Ability to schedule and manage resources to meet department goals.
- Interpersonal skills necessary to deal courteously and effectively with supervisors, co-workers and clients.
- Communication skills necessary to handle telephone inquiries from clients.
- Ability to deal with client information in a confidential manner.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, and Outlook) and Laboratory Information Systems.
